French Interior Ministry Previously Dismissed 'Internal Interference' Concept
A Le Figaro article recalls that in 2025, the French Interior Ministry, through then-Secretary General Hugues Moutouh, had already dismissed the concept of 'internal interference' during a Senate roundtable, stating that interference does not apply when the threat is not of foreign origin.
